Description
 

Selected specifically for its ability to produce a unique fruit forward ester profile desired in East Coast styles of beer. Promotes hop biotransformation and accentuates hop flavor and aroma.

  • Attenutation: Medium-High
  • Flocculation: Medium
  • Ideal Temperature: 59-72 F
  • Alcohol Tolerance: 9%

5 of 5 Made cider and perry with this July 26, 2024
Reviewer: Matty Minski from Milton, MA United States  
8.5g in a 5-gallon batch of 70-brix apple concentrate mixed to ~21 brix, the same with a batch of 70-brix pear concentrate, both got the requisite fermaid-o and pectic enzxyme.  In a steady 65º-70º both finished in just under 14 days sharp, fruity, and crystal clear. SG was 1.084, FG was 1.002, 10.99% AVB.  Yes, those are the readings I got from my always calibrated beforehand hydrometer (you'd think the paper inside would be attached somehow, but no, so always check it.)

2 of 5 Sensitive/low attenuating January 28, 2024
Reviewer: Christopher Gifford-Miears from Duluth, MN United States  
No fault of RiteBrew, but this yeast resulted in a ~68% attenuation compared to Safale-05’s ~77% (split batch, same wort, aeration, and fermentation). First attempt use, so potentially a one off result, but keep in mind if targeting a low teens final gravity when thinking of using this yeast.
